You really, really, really need to start saving them as a lossless format like I do so you preserve the original beauty of the solid pixels. The JPG compression algorithm for MS Paint is horrible, and it creates artifacts around everything and makes the whole picture look ugly and wasted.
The best option is to save them as a format that uses color reference tables like GIF or PNG, if saved correctly your MS Paint pictures will take up almost no space at all, and they will not lose any quality from the original. If you have Adobe Photoshop, import your 24-bit BMP from paint in and select File > Save for web. This is a quick and easy solution to creating small lossless files to store and show off your paint masterpieces.
